Alpine.js
Development
Alpine.js is a lightweight JavaScript framework that allows you to add behavior to your markup. It provides reactive data binding and declarative handling of DOM elements without the need for a virtual DOM. Alpine makes it easy to create interactive components and UIs without a complex setup.

Hoodie
Development
Hoodie is an open-source JavaScript library for front-end web development. It provides a simple API and tools for building offline-first web apps by handling data synchronization, persistent storage, and user authentication out of the box.
